Spalletta Multi-rate Series 2.67Gb/s transceiver module integrates optics and electronics in a Small Form Factor Pluggable (SFP) package. It is Multisource Agreement (MSA) compatible and designed for operation at 1310 nm and 1550 nm. Although optimized for OC-48/STM-16, it provides multi-rate capabilities and can be used from OC-3/STM-1(155 Mb/s) up to 2.7 Gb/s. MultiRate SFP transceiver provides a fully OC-48 SONET compliant interface between the SONET/SDH photonic layer and the electrical layer. Its microprocessor - based modular design implements all features specified in the SFP MSA compatible 2-wire Serial Digital Diagnostic Monitoring Interface for Optical Transceivers. OC-48 / STM-16 is a network line with transmission speeds of up to 2488.32 Mbit/s (payload: 2405.376 Mbit/s; overhead: 82.944 Mbit/s).
OC-3/STM-1 is a network line with transmission speeds of up to 155.52 Mbit/s (payload: 148.608 Mbit/s; overhead: 6.912 Mbit/s, including path overhead) using fiber optics. Depending on the system OC-3 is also known as STS-3 (electrical level) and STM-1 (SDH). These modules are also used for Fast Ethernet application.
OC-12 or STM-4 is a network line with transmission speeds of up to 622.08 Mbit/s (payload: 601.344 Mbit/s; overhead: 20.736 Mbit/s).
Part nr.: | Fiber Type | Data Rate Range | Wavelength | Optical Components | Distance | Case Temperature range | DDM |
SO-SFP600MSXM | MMF | ≤ 622Mbps | 850nm | FP/PIN | 1km | Com./Ind. | D |
SO-SFP600MLX2M | MMF | ≤ 622Mbps | 1310nm | FP/PIN | 2km | Com./Ind. | D |
SO-SFP600MLX15 | SMF | ≤ 622Mbps | 1310nm | FP/PIN | 15km | Com./Ind. | D |
SO-SFP600MLX40 | SMF | ≤ 622Mbps | 1310nm | FP/PIN | 40km | Com./Ind. | D |
SO-SFP600MZX80 | SMF | ≤ 622Mbps | 1550nm | DFB/PIN | 80km | Com./Ind. | D |
SO-SFP600MZX120 | SMF | ≤ 622Mbps | 1550nm | DFB/PIN | 120km | Com./Ind. | D |
SO-SFP600MZX160 | SMF | ≤ 622Mbps | 1550nm | DFB/APD | 160km | Com./Ind. | D |
SO-SFP2GLX2 | SMF | ≤ 2.5Gbps | 1310nm | FP/PIN | 2km | Com./Ind. | D |
SO-SFP2GLX10 | SMF | ≤ 2.5Gbps | 1310nm | FP/PIN | 10km | Com./Ind. | D |
SO-SFP2GLX15 | SMF | ≤ 2.5Gbps | 1310nm | DFB/PIN | 15km | Com./Ind. | D |
SO-SFP2GLX40 | SMF | ≤ 2.5Gbps | 1310nm | DFB/APD | 40km | Com./Ind. | D |
SO-SFP2GZX40 | SMF | ≤ 2.5Gbps | 1550nm | DFB/PIN | 40km | Com./Ind. | D |
SO-SFP2GZX80 | SMF | ≤ 2.5Gbps | 1550nm | DFB/APD | 80km | Com./Ind. | D |
SO-SFP2GZX100 | SMF | ≤ 2.5Gbps | 1550nm | DFB/APD | 100km | Com./Ind. | D |
SO-SFP2GZX120 | SMF | ≤ 2.5Gbps | 1550nm | DFB/APD | 120km | Com./Ind. | D |
SO-SFP2.6GSXM | MMF | ≤ 2.67Gbps | 850nm | VCSEL/PIN | 550m | Com./Ind. | D |
SO-SFP2.6GLX2 | SMF | ≤ 2.67Gbps | 1310nm | FP/PIN | 2km | Com./Ind. | D |
SO-SFP2.6GLX10 | SMF | ≤ 2.67Gbps | 1310nm | FP/PIN | 10km | Com./Ind. | D |
SO-SFP2.6GLX15 | SMF | ≤ 2.67Gbps | 1310nm | DFB/PIN | 15km | Com./Ind. | D |
SO-SFP2.6GLX40 | SMF | ≤ 2.67Gbps | 1310nm | DFB/APD | 40km | Com./Ind. | D |
SO-SFP2.6GLX1555 | SMF | ≤ 2.67Gbps | 1550nm | DFB/PIN | 15km | Com./Ind. | D |
SO-SFP2.6GZX40 | SMF | ≤ 2.67Gbps | 1550nm | DFB/PIN | 40km | Com./Ind. | D |
SO-SFP2.6GZX80 | SMF | ≤ 2.67Gbps | 1550nm | DFB/APD | 80km | Com./Ind. | D |
SO-SFP2.6GZX100 | SMF | ≤ 2.67Gbps | 1550nm | DFB/APD | 100km | Com./Ind. | D |
SO-SFP2.6GZX120 | SMF | ≤ 2.67Gbps | 1550nm | DFB/APD | 120km | Com./Ind. | D |
